Strong access does not fix weak servers

Protecting access is essential. VPN, RDP, SSO, administrator consoles and sensitive internal applications should not rely on passwords alone. Strong authentication, clear access policies and centralized identity controls reduce the chance that a stolen password becomes a direct path into the environment.

But access control answers only one part of the security question. It helps determine who can enter, through which path, with which authentication method and under which policy. It does not automatically answer another question that matters just as much: what is the state of the system behind that access?

A server can sit behind MFA and still be fragile. It may expose services that no longer have a business reason to run. It may contain vulnerable packages, expired certificates, weak SSH settings, excessive sudo rules, privileged local accounts or undocumented configuration changes. In that case, the front door is better protected, but the room behind it still needs attention.

This distinction matters because many organizations start by strengthening the most visible entry points. That is a good move. The practical lesson is not that access security is insufficient. It is that access security works better when it is connected to infrastructure reality. If an administrator connects through a protected RDP path, the organization should still know whether the target server is patched, monitored and configured correctly. If VPN access is controlled, teams should still know which internal systems are reachable and whether those systems carry avoidable risk.

Strong access reduces exposure at the entry point and healthy servers reduce exposure after entry. A credible security strategy needs both: control who gets in, then verify what they can reach.
